Where You’ll Make a Difference

  • Serve as the first point of contact for HR-related queries, providing Tier 1 support through multiple communication channels.
  • Manage day-to-day HR data entry operations across various Human Capital Management (HCM) systems, ensuring 100% accuracy for all employee lifecycle events (e.g., onboarding, offboarding, changes, and leave management).
  • Maintain and update People Operations processes and work instructions to ensure compliance with local audit and legal standards.
  • Collaborate with local HR teams and Centers of Excellence (COEs) to ensure seamless execution of HR processes, including payroll and administrative tasks.
  • Educate employees and managers on internal HR policies, procedures, and available resources.
  • Handle and resolve employee queries within defined Key Performance Indicators (KPIs), escalating complex issues when necessary.
  • Generate regular and ad-hoc HR reports to support leadership decision-making.
  • Manage the People Operations inbox, ensuring timely and accurate responses to employee inquiries.
  • Create and issue employment documentation such as contracts, starter packs, and termination letters, ensuring alignment with HR processes.
